Don't forget the little things like cutlery and cooking utensils.
A kitchen timer is a God-send.
Tell me about it!
Kettle, cutlery, mugs, plates, bowls, knives, chopping board, saucepans, frying pan, cooking dishes, tea towels, scissors, bottle opener, tin opener, cooking untensils! It just goes on.
Then things like a table, lamps, bedside cabinet, hoover, iron, ironing board!

southernscouser wrote: »Guys, do you think furnishing a flat for £3,500 is reasonable? :undecided
I'm just scouting around prices for bits and bobs (ie at Argos) just to get a general feel and I can blow that easily! :rotfl:
Admittedly I may have budgetted £750 for a 40" TVbut it doesn't seem to stretch far!
So far I'm budgetting;
Sofas - £750Dont need to spend that much I got 2 leather sofas from Argos for £500
TV - £750 Boys and their toys eh?
Fridge/freezer - £300 about right
Washing machine - £300 should get one for about £200
Microwave - £100 Made of gold is it??? Or are you going to use this for all cooking as I cant see a cooker on your list.
Bed/mattress - £500 Always worth getting a decent bed, it will get alot of hammer
Wardrobe - £300 about right
Bedside cabinet - £50 OK
And there is so much missing from that list! :eek:
